Rock Hill, SC Demographics

What is the population of Rock Hill?

There are 74,170 residents in Rock Hill, with a median age of 34.5. Of this, 46.3% are males and 53.7% are females. US-born citizens make up 93.81% of the resident pool in Rock Hill, while non-US-born citizens account for 3.21%. Additionally, 2.98% of the population is represented by non-citizens. A total of 60,750 people in Rock Hill currently live in the same house as they did last year.

What are the employment statistics in Rock Hill?

White-collar workers make up 77.49% of the working population in Rock Hill, while blue-collar employees account for 22.51%. There are also 2,711 entrepreneurs in Rock Hill (7.2% of the workforce); 27,610 workers employed in private companies (73.36%); and 5,095 people working in governmental institutions (13.54%).

How many households are there in Rock Hill?

There are a total of 30,457 households in Rock Hill, each made up of around 2 members. Family establishments represent 57.25% of these Rock Hill households, while non-family units account for the remaining 42.75%. Additionally, 28.14% of households have children and 71.86% of households are without children.

What are the median and average incomes in Rock Hill?

The average annual household income in Rock Hill is $80,609, while the median household income sits at $60,807 per year. Residents aged 25 to 44 earn $65,251, while those between 45 and 64 years old have a median wage of $70,799. In contrast, people younger than 25 and those older than 65 earn less, at $41,542 and $44,601, respectively.

How many homeowners and renters are there in Rock Hill?

There are 32,512 housing units in Rock Hill, and the median year in which these properties were built is 1994. Of the 30,457 occupied housing units in Rock Hill, 51.79% are owner-occupied, while 48.21% have renters living in them. Meanwhile, properties bought with mortgages account for 69.79% of the units, and the median value of a home with a mortgage is $243,800. In general, housing costs reach $1,172 per month in Rock Hill.

What is the level of education in Rock Hill?

Approximately 29.81% of the population in Rock Hill holds a high school degree (that's 17,086 residents), while 28.82% have attained a college certificate (16,964 locals) and 18.31% have a bachelor's degree (10,494 people).

What is the marital status of Rock Hill residents?

A total of 24,140 people in Rock Hill have never been married (which represents 40.14% of the total population), while 25,932 of them are wedded (43.12%). Separated and divorced residents are in smaller numbers, at 1,660 (2.76%) and 6,455 (10.73%), respectively.

What are the most common means of transportation in Rock Hill?

The top three means of transportation people in Rock Hill use to get to work are: car, walking and bus or trolley bus. A total of 32,364 residents commute by car, 1,047 prefer going to work by walking and 244 by bus or trolley bus

Methodology & Disclaimers

Demographic data shown in this section was gathered from the latest U.S. Census Bureau release, the 2022 American Community Survey. The information is updated yearly, as soon as new data is made available by the US Census Bureau.
